GREENSBORO, N.C. – The Auctioneers Association of North Carolina made several key initiatives at its annual January Convention on Jan.15-17 at the Embassy Suites in Greensboro.
Will Lilly of Iron Horse Auction Company and a MarkNet Alliance member in Rockingham has been elected President of the AANC at the event’s membership meeting.
Lilly will lead an 11-member board for the AANC, which has been serving auctioneers, auction assistants and their staffs in and around North Carolina for more than 50 years. The AANC has more than 450 members and associates throughout North Carolina and the United States.
Walter House, of House Auction Company and a MarkNet Alliance member in Marshallberg, NC won the Auctioneers Grand Championship, Brian Kurdziolek of Chesterfield, Va., won the Reserve Championship, and Ben Farrell of Ben Farrell Auction & Real Estate in Pittsboro won First Runner-Up.
